Boost Child & Youth Advocacy Centre (Boost CYAC) is a creative community response to child abuse investigations. A partnership among local community and government agencies, it brings together all professionals involved in child abuse cases under one roof, for a coordinated, seamless, interdisciplinary response to child abuse victims in Toronto. The CYAC space is accessible, safe, and child and family-friendly. We have a child interview room, and a child examination room where physical and sexual abuse examinations can be performed. The interview rooms are equipped with recording equipment, to document and preserve a child’s statement so it can be used in the criminal justice process – and reduce the child’s trauma in repeatedly telling his/her experience of abuse. Our team of highly-skilled professionals collaborate on cases, take actions that prevent re-victimization, and support the child’s long-term well-being, as well as non-offending family members. Our goal is to provide a centre of leadership, promoting excellence in child abuse prevention, support services, research, training and education – a collective community response to protecting Toronto’s children from abuse. Boost CYAC’s community service partners in the City of Toronto include: Children’s Aid Society of Toronto, Catholic Children’s Aid Society of Toronto, Native Child & Family Services, Jewish Family & Child, Toronto Police Service, SAFE-T Program (Halton Trauma Centre), Child Development Institute, and the Suspected Child Abuse and Neglect Program (The Hospital for Sick Children).
